Seven explosions rock Hat Yai, nine injured

Hat Yai, Songkhla - Seven coordinated bomb attacks were launched in this bustling tourist southern town Sunday night, injuring nine people.

Thailand 'disappointed' at Suu Kyi extension

Thailand's army-installed government on Sunday said it was "disappointed" with neighbouring Burma's decision to extend the house arrest of opposition leader Aung San Suu Kyi.

Women outraged over Suu Kyi detention
Today marks the fourth anniversary of Aung San Suu Kyi's detention since she was placed under house arrest after her supporters and those of the government clashed at Depayin township in northern Burma.
